Comprehending Conservatories
Before diving into renovation, it is vital to comprehend what a conservatory is. A conservatory is generally specified as a structure with glass walls and a glass roof, created to cultivate and display plants, while also serving as a recreational area. They can differ significantly in terms of style, size, and function, ranging from little sunrooms to extensive garden rooms.

Renovating a conservatory requires mindful preparation and thoughtful decision-making. Here are some essential aspects to think about:
Assess the Current Condition: Before initiating any renovation, examine the existing state of your conservatory. Keep an eye out for:
Cracks or leaks in the glass panelsStructural stability issuesWeakening frames or seals
Set a Budget: Establish a practical spending plan that encompasses all aspects of the renovation, consisting of products, labor, and any unforeseen expenses. Here's a standard breakdown:
Materials: Glass, roof, framing, flooring, and paint.Labor: Hiring experts or contractors versus DIY choices.Surfaces: Furnishing, design, and landscaping.
Choose the Right Materials: Selecting the proper materials can have a long-lasting effect on the conservatory's sturdiness and effectiveness:
Double or triple-glazed windows for much better insulation.UV-protective glass to protect interior home furnishings from sunshine damage.Sustainable or environmentally friendly products that reflect a commitment to ecological responsibility.
Maintain Architectural Style: Ensure that the refurbished conservatory matches the existing architecture of your home. This can generally be attained through:
Matching colors with the present outside.Selecting design components that balance with the general home visual.
Customize the Space: Consider how the conservatory will be used and individualize it accordingly-- whether that's adding integrated furnishings, art work, or plants. Here are some popular uses:
Home OfficeYoga or Meditation SpaceGames RoomGreenhouse for Plant Enthusiasts
Integrate Energy Efficiency: Prioritize energy-efficient features to decrease expenses and environmental effect. Essential upgrades may consist of:
Solar panels on the roof.Insulated floor covering or thermal blinds to maintain temperature level control.Efficient heating and cooling systems.Renovation Process: Step-by-Step Guide

The ideal time for renovation is normally throughout the spring or early summer when the weather is mild, and contractors are quicker offered.
How long does a conservatory renovation generally take?
The period of renovation can differ from a couple of weeks to numerous months, depending on the degree of the work needed and the materials selected.
Are there any permits needed for conservatory renovation?
Regulations differ by place. It's suggested to speak with local authorities or a specialist knowledgeable about regional building codes.
Can I pursue a DIY conservatory renovation?
While some aspects (like painting and design) might be manageable on a DIY basis, structural work or specialized setups should preferably be handled by specialists.
What features can I include to a conservatory for better functionality?
Think about integrating functions such as automatic blinds, ceiling fans, heating systems, and even a little kitchen space to enhance use.
